Recent works in our laboratory have shown that novel classes of light-absorbing and luminescent metal-containing molecular materials could be assembled through the use of various metal-ligand and coordination chromophoric building blocks.In this presentation,various design and synthetic strategies will be described.A number of these metal-ligand chromophoric complexes and coordination compounds have been shown to display rich optical and luminescence behavior.Correlations of the chromophoric and luminescence behavior with the electronic and structural effects of the metal complexes and coordination compounds have been made to elucidate their spectroscopic origins.
